2020, 12″ LP, Ne’Astra Music Group/Barak Records. Red vinyl.
Having previously offered live, orchestral style interpretations of works by Madvillain (AKA Madlib and MF Doom) and J Dilla, Leeds collective Abstract Orchestra has decided to tackle the early works of Slum Village, and specifically their “Fan-Tas-Tic Volume 2” album from the late 90s. The resultant set is inspired, delivering warm, soulful and jazzy interpretations of Dilla’s brilliant beats and layered backing tracks that makes extensive use of strings, woodwind, brass and some suitably soulful singers. Excitingly, the remaining members of Slum Village add their distinctive flows to a number of key cuts, too, adding an air of legitimacy to a project rooted in love for one of hip-hop’s greatest albums. – Juno
